Layered Ice Cream Sandwich Cake

An impressive dessert with just three ingredients and minimal effort. Perfect for busy hosts, last-minute gatherings, or anyone craving a decadent treat.

Servings 12
Calories 320 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 24 ice cream sandwiches (standard size) Let ice cream sandwiches sit at room temperature for 1-2 minutes before handling to prevent cracking
  • 16 oz whipped topping Chill your mixing bowl before making homemade whipped cream for better volume
  • 1/2 cup chocolate syrup

Instructions
 

  • Prepare a 9x13 inch baking dish by lining it with parchment paper or lightly greasing it. This makes removal easier after freezing.
  • Unwrap 12 ice cream sandwiches and arrange them in a single layer in the prepared dish. You may need to trim some sandwiches to fit perfectly.
  • Spread an even layer of whipped topping over the ice cream sandwiches. Use about half of your whipped topping for this first layer.
  • Drizzle chocolate syrup generously over the whipped topping layer. Use about 1/4 cup for this first drizzle.
  • Repeat the layers with the remaining 12 ice cream sandwiches, arranging them carefully over the first layer.
  • Spread the remaining whipped topping over the second layer of ice cream sandwiches.
  • Finish with another generous drizzle of chocolate syrup, using the remaining 1/4 cup.
  • Cover the dish tightly with plastic wrap or aluminum foil and freeze for at least 2-3 hours, or until completely firm.
  • When ready to serve, remove from freezer and let sit at room temperature for 5 minutes before slicing.
  • Use a sharp knife dipped in hot water to cut clean slices. Wipe the knife between cuts for neat presentation.

Notes

For a lighter option, use low-fat or reduced-sugar ice cream sandwiches, light whipped topping, or sugar-free chocolate syrup. Store tightly covered in freezer for up to 2 weeks.
